And he did so with a social conscience: In 1987, 15
years before the establishment
of the Rooney Rule (requiring NFL teams to interview at least one minority
candidate for head
coaching vacancies), Walsh took the lead in an NFL internship program for minority
coaches, bringing prospective assistants into training camp each
year and giving them significant responsibility.
